Figure 2 in A spectacular new species of Hyloscirtus (Anura: Hylidae) from the Cordillera de Los Llanganates in the eastern Andes of Ecuador

Figure 2 Linear regression of divergence time vs genetic distance for some Hyloscirtus species of the Hyloscirtus larinopygion group. Line (A) is the unconstrained regression line. Line (B) is constrained to pass through the origin. Red segments represent the ranges of genetic distances (2.2–2.9%) and inferred divergence times between H. sethmacfarlenei sp. nov.and H. tigrinus, the known species with the smallest genetic distance to the new species. The estimated divergence time should be considered only a rough estimate. Full-size DOI: 10.7717/peerj.14066/fig-2

FIGURE 7. A in Forty years later: a new Andean stream treefrog of the genus Hyloscirtus (Anura: Hylidae) from Ecuador, with comments on arm hypertrophy in the H. larinopygion group

FIGURE 7. A. Dorsal view of left forearm of Hyloscirtus arcanus sp. nov. adult male KU 202728 with the three slips of the m. abductor pollicis longus highlighted. White highlights tendons; maroon highlights the slip originating via fleshy attachments on the radioulna; teal highlights the slip originating via a tendon on the distal epicondyle of humerus; olive highlights the slip originating via a fleshy attachment on the cristal lateralis of humerus. The following muscles were previously removed: m. extensor communis, m. extensor carpi ulnaris, m. epicondylo-cubitalis, and m. epitrochleo-cubitalis. Scale bar = 3 mm. B. Ventral cut on abdomen of Hyloscirtus arcanus sp. nov. female specimen (KU 202729) revealing the large and mature oviducal oocytes, with unpigmented animal pole. Scale bar = 2 mm.

FIGURE 10 in A new species of Hyloscirtus (Anura, Hylidae) from the Colombian and Venezuelan slopes of Sierra de Perijá, and the phylogenetic position of Hyloscirtus jahni (Rivero, 1961)

FIGURE 10. Calling sites of Hyloscirtus japreria sp. nov. (a) Hidden behind water curtains of small cascades (white arrow indicates the localization of the image magnified in the right frame), (b) from water tanks of bromeliads, and (c) exposed above leaves and branches of bushes above the creek. Photos: F.J.M. Rojas-Runjaic.
